ENGLISH SCURVYGRASS Cochlearia anglica (Brassicaceae) Height to 35cm. Biennial or perennial of estuaries and coastal mudflats. FLOWERS are 10-14mm across with 4 white petals (Apr-Jul). FRUITS are elliptical and 10-15mm long. LEAVES are long-stalked and narrow; basal leaves taper gradually to the base while stem leaves clasp the stem. STATUS-Locally common around most coasts in suitable habitats.
